The majority of Europe's glaciers are found in the Alps, Caucasus and the Scandinavian Mountains (mostly Norway) as well as in Iceland. Iceland has the largest glacier in Europe, Vatnajökull Glacier, that covers between 8,100 and 8,300 km 2 in area and 3,100 km 3 in volume. There are around 880 glaciers in Washington state, with 186 named according to the Geographic Names Information System (GNIS). [6] However, the 1980 eruption of Mount St. Helens eliminated nine of its eleven named glaciers and only the new glacier known as Crater Glacier has been reestablished since. A glacier with a sustained negative balance loses equilibrium and retreats. A sustained positive balance is also out of equilibrium and will advance to reestablish equilibrium. Currently, nearly all glaciers have a negative mass balance and are retreating. [13] Glacier retreat results in the loss of the low-elevation region of the glacier.
